The Pennsylvania Supreme Court on Saturday night dismissed a lawsuit from US Rep. Mike Kelly and other Republicans, after they had tried to invalidate absentee voting and block the certification of votes, CNN reports.
The court was unanimous in deciding against Kelly and others, and refusing to block vote certification. Five of the seven judges wrote that they believed the lawsuit had been filed far too late, a year after absentee voting procedures had been established in the state and weeks after millions of Pennsylvanians voted in good faith.
